NavigationWindow.SandboxExternalContent 屬性
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
取得或設定一個值,指示是否 NavigationWindow 在部分信任安全沙盒(預設網際網路區域權限設定)中隔離外部可擴充應用程式標記語言(XAML)內容。
public:
property bool SandboxExternalContent { bool get(); void set(bool value); };
public bool SandboxExternalContent { get; set; }
member this.SandboxExternalContent : bool with get, set
Public Property SandboxExternalContent As Boolean
屬性值
true若內容被隔離在部分信任安全沙盒中;否則,。 false 預設值為 false。
例外狀況
SandboxExternalContent 當應用程式以部分信任執行時,會設定。
備註
外部內容是指未隨應用程式包含的 XAML 內容,無論是資源檔案還是內容檔案(欲了解更多資訊,請參見 WPF 應用程式資源、內容與資料檔案)。
當 SandboxExternalContent 為真且 NavigationWindow 內容為外部 XAML 檔案時,內容會載入一個部分信任安全沙盒,該沙盒限制於預設的網際網路區域權限設定。 此外,外部內容會載入到獨立的程序中。 因此,外部內容會被隔離,無法存取應用範圍的資源,例如資源字典(更多資訊請參見 ResourceDictionary)。
備註
NavigationWindow 只有當屬性 Source 設定為外部 XAML 檔案的統一資源識別碼(URI)時,才包含外部內容。 NavigationWindow 使用該 Content 屬性提供的內容被視為內部內容,因此不會被隔離。
相依財產資訊
| 項目 | 價值 |
|---|---|
| 識別碼欄位 | SandboxExternalContent |
元資料屬性設為 true |
沒有 |